Biotrexate 500mg Injection 1s 5ml should only be administered under the supervision of a healthcare professional and should not be selfadministered The dosage and frequency of administration will be determined by your doctor based on your specific condition and may be subject to change It is important to follow your doctors instructions carefully as taking the medication incorrectly or in excessive amounts can result in serious side effects It may take some time before you see or feel the benefits of the medication so do not stop taking it unless instructed by your doctor Avoid consuming alcohol during treatment as it can increase the risk of liver damage Common side effects of Biotrexate 500mg Injection 1s 5ml may include nausea vomiting loss of appetite abdominal pain tiredness and mouth sores Your doctor may recommend taking folic acid to help reduce these side effects If the side effects persist or worsen inform your doctor as there may be ways to prevent or alleviate them This medication is potent and may cause serious side effects in some individuals including a weakened immune system blood liver or kidney problems Regular blood tests will be conducted by your doctor to monitor for any potential complications Prior to taking this medication inform your doctor if you have any stomach liver or kidney issues or if you are currently taking any medications for infections It is important to disclose all medications you are using to your healthcare team as this medication can interact with many other drugs Biotrexate 500mg Injection 1s 5ml is not recommended for use during pregnancy or while breastfeeding as it can harm the baby You and your partner should take precautions to avoid pregnancy for several months after completing treatment with this medication Your doctor may conduct various tests such as blood tests Xrays and physical examinations both before and during your treatment with Biotrexate 500mg Injection 1s 5ml

What are the serious side effects of Cabita?
Cabita a medication commonly prescribed for certain medical conditions may have some severe side effects that should not be ignored These side effects include but are not limited to diarrhea nausea vomiting the development of sores in the mouth and swelling pain redness or peeling of the skin on the palms of the hands and soles of the feet Additionally individuals using Cabita may also experience fever chills a sore throat or other signs of an infection as well as swelling in the hands feet ankles or lower legs It is important to note that if you experience chest pain or pressure a rapid heartbeat dark urine or yellowing of the skin or eyes you should promptly inform your doctor Early intervention and communication with your healthcare provider are crucial in managing these potential side effects effectively and ensuring your wellbeing Remember it is essential to report any adverse symptoms promptly to receive appropriate medical care and ensure your safety while taking Cabita

What is the most important information that I should know about Pecitabin?
It is crucial to be aware that the consumption of Pecitabin may have an impact on the effectiveness of blood thinners such as warfarin This potential interference can result in alterations in the clot formation rate and may lead to severe bleeding with fatal consequences Cancer patients particularly those who fall in the age bracket of 60 years and above have a heightened vulnerability to this risk If you encounter any symptoms such as abnormal bleeding the regurgitation of blood or coffee groundlike substance the presence of bloody or black stool with a tarlike consistency blood in urine urine that appears red or dark brown or inexplicable bruising it is imperative to seek immediate medical assistance Your health and wellbeing should never be compromised and prompt medical attention can play a crucial role in ensuring your safety when encountering the aforementioned symptoms
